GU10 bulbs are a type of spotlight bulb that is characterized by its unique twist and lock base These bulbs are typically used in track lighting, recessed lighting, and display lighting fixtures The “GU” in GU10 stands for “guillotine,” indicating the two pins on the base that lock the bulb into place This design ensures a secure connection and easy installation.

One of the significant advantages of GU10 bulbs is their energy efficiency Most GU10 bulbs utilize LED technology, which consumes significantly less energy compared to traditional incandescent bulbs LED GU10 bulbs can last up to 25 times longer, resulting in reduced electricity bills and lower maintenance costs Moreover, they produce less heat, making them safer and more comfortable to handle.

Another key feature of GU10 bulbs is their directional light output Unlike traditional bulbs that emit light in all directions, GU10 bulbs focus their light beam in a specific direction This makes them perfect for highlighting objects or illuminating specific areas, such as artwork or task surfaces The narrow beam angle not only enhances the aesthetic appeal but also reduces light spillage, making them ideal for accent lighting purposes.

For general room lighting, a bulb with a higher lumen output is recommended On the other hand, lower lumen bulbs are suitable for creating ambiance or accentuating particular features.

Color temperature is another vital aspect to consider It refers to the warmth or coolness of the light emitted by the bulb and is measured in Kelvin (K) Warm white light (2700K-3000K) creates a cozy and inviting atmosphere, ideal for living spaces and bedrooms Cool white light (4000K-5000K), on the other hand, provides a brighter and more focused light, making it preferable for task-oriented areas like kitchens and offices.

Maintenance is also a breeze with GU10 bulbs Unlike traditional bulbs that require frequent replacing, GU10 LED bulbs have an impressive lifespan of up to 25,000 hours or more This means less hassle and fewer replacements, saving you time and money in the long run.
